THIS WEEK’S PAC-10 PICKS:
Last season UCLA traveled to South Bend and dominated Notre Dame – for 59 minutes. It was that last minute that hurt.
The Irish went 80 yards in three plays to rally for a 20-17 victory.
The loss has stuck in the craw of the Bruins for a year. Now they get their chance to avenge the defeat in the Rose Bowl. The Irish don’t have Brady Quinn this time, or any wins for that matter.
They won’t have one after Saturday, either.
As always, the spreads are for entertainment purposes only.
Notre Dame at UCLA (UCLA by 20 1/2): The last time the Irish played in the Rose Bowl, the Four Horsemen were still riding – and Notre Dame won once in a while. UCLA 27-14.
Arizona at Oregon State (Oregon State by 4): If the Beavers hold on to the ball, they have a shot. If not, Arizona will have a two-game winning streak. Arizona 34-31
Stanford at USC (USC by 38 1/2): Harbaugh pops off. Strike one. USC struggles last week. Strike two. Stanford loses its quarterback. Strike three. USC 45-3.
Arizona State at Washington State (ASU by 8 1/2): The Sun Devils need just two wins to be bowl eligible. The Cougars just need a win. Arizona State 42-35.
